Securing a permanent job in the Netherlands offers stability and long-term security for EU migrant workers. These positions are typically full-time, with contracts that last at least one year, often renewable or indefinite if performance and legal requirements are met. Common industries include logistics, construction, food production, and hotel services. Permanent roles provide benefits like paid holidays, pension contributions, and access to Dutch social security systems. What to Expect
Working permanently in the Netherlands usually involves standard full-time hours, from 36 to 40 hours per week, with some positions offering overtime or flexible schedules. The work environment emphasizes safety, professionalism, and respect. Physical demands vary by industry, but many jobs require standing, lifting, or operating machinery. Expect to work in well-organized facilities with modern equipment. Employers often provide instructions in Dutch or English, and workplace rights are protected by Dutch labor law. It's common to have regular shifts, with opportunities for additional hours, especially during busy seasons or peak production periods. Requirements
To qualify for permanent positions, employers generally require previous work experience relevant to the role, basic Dutch language skills or good English communication, and valid documentation for legal employment. A residence permit for the Netherlands or proof of EU nationality is essential. Having a BSN (Burger Service Nummer) is mandatory for working and accessing social services. Some roles might ask for specific certifications or training, especially in construction or food safety. Basic computer knowledge can be an advantage, and a good work ethic is highly valued. No extensive Dutch language skills are necessary for many roles, especially in logistics or manufacturing, making these ideal entry points for new arrivals.
Salary & Benefits
In 2026, the minimum wage in the Netherlands for workers aged 21 and over is €14.71 per hour. Many permanent jobs pay between €15 and €20 per hour depending on industry, experience, and location. Benefits include paid vacation days (typically four times your weekly hours), pension contributions, and sometimes extra allowances for transportation or meals. Employers also ensure compliance with Dutch collective labor agreements (CAO), giving workers rights to sick leave, holiday pay, and safe working conditions.
